yes, if methadone is specifically tested for. Most of the time methadone is not tested for, but on tests with more panels a test for methadone will be present. Methadone does not show up in the urine as an opiate.
Methadone can stay in the urine 3 to 5 days depending on the rate of metabolism.

Methadone is a synthetic opiate. Detection time in urine- 1-7 days
Typical illicet drug urine tests don't test for methadone since there is a specific test just for methadone to detect it.
Typically, methadone stays in the urine 3 to 5 days depending on the rate of metabolism.
